The Masterclass Certificate in Indigenous Digital Heritage Management is a timely and crucial course that bridges the gap between cultural preservation and technological innovation. This program emphasizes the importance of digital tools in preserving and promoting indigenous heritage, language, and knowledge systems, thus addressing industry demands for professionals who can work effectively and respectfully with indigenous communities.

Detalles del Curso


โ€ข Indigenous Data Sovereignty
โ€ข Digital Heritage Preservation Techniques
โ€ข Cultural Intellectual Property Rights in Digital Heritage
โ€ข Community-Driven Digital Heritage Projects
โ€ข Digital Storytelling and Traditional Knowledge
โ€ข Best Practices for Indigenous Digital Heritage Management
โ€ข Digital Tools for Indigenous Language Revitalization
โ€ข Collaborative Partnerships in Indigenous Digital Heritage
โ€ข Case Studies in Indigenous Digital Heritage Management
โ€ข Ethics and Protocols in Indigenous Digital Heritage
